Descriptive Summary

As a Flooring Materials Sourcing Specialist, you will be responsible for identifying, evaluating, and procuring flooring materials for construction and renovation projects. Your role involves researching suppliers, negotiating contracts, and ensuring the quality and timely delivery of materials. You will collaborate closely with project managers, architects, and contractors to meet project requirements and budgets.

Essential Functions
  • Conduct thorough market research to identify potential suppliers of flooring materials, tools, and equipment.
  • Evaluate supplier capabilities, product quality, pricing, and delivery terms to determine suitability for partnership.
  • Negotiate contracts, pricing, and terms with suppliers to ensure favorable agreements for ILG.
  • Manage relationships with existing suppliers, monitoring performance and addressing any issues that may arise.
  • Continuously monitor market trends, industry developments, and technological advancements to identify new sourcing opportunities and cost-saving initiatives.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ders, including procurement, sales, and project management teams, to understand sourcing needs and develop strategies to meet business objectives.
  • Maintain accurate records of supplier contracts, pricing agreements, and product specifications.
  • Coordinate with logistics and warehouse teams to ensure timely delivery of materials to project sites.
  • Stay informed about environmental regulations and sustainability initiatives related to flooring materials and suppliers.
Education &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in business administration, supply chain management, or a related field.
  • Proven experience as a sourcing specialist, procurement officer, or similar role, preferably within the construction or home improvement industry.
Skills & Competencies
  • Strong negotiation skills with the ability to secure favorable terms and pricing from suppliers.
  • Excellent analytical skills and att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and experience working with procurement software or ERP systems.
  •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to multitask and prioritize workload in a fast-paced environment.
  • Knowledge of flooring materials, installation methods, and industry standards is preferred.
  • Familiarity with sustainability practices and regulations related to sourcing is a plus.
